FREEWHEELERS CHRISTMAS OUTING Meeting at the Champions bar in Benimar for the start of their Christmas lunch the Freewheelers were greeted with the option of a hot mince pie and a glass of gluh wine (or tea or coffee) for just €1 plus a free slice of Marzipan Stollent, a German specialty at Christmas to get the celebrations started. After meeting and greeting friends old a new and being introduced to some first-timers the group motored sedately down to La Marina and el Castello for a three course lunch with drinks included and as usual the wine flowed freely. Unfortunately some left before the entertainment started which was provided by the vocals Juan who sang and played songs from classic artists and musicals of yesteryear. Some danced, some sang along with him and who can forget the duet with a well known pie man of "New York! New York!" Including the dance steps. Priceless. All too soon, with the sun disappearing below the treetops it was time to head home and reminisce on another Freewheelers day out.
